Derval
Derval is a locality in Derval, Arrondissement of Châteaubriant-Ancenis, Pays de la Loire and has about 3,130 residents. Derval is situated nearby to the hamlet Croquemais, as well as near the village Mouais.- Type: Locality with 3,130 residents

Derval Castle
Castle
Photo: Pymouss44,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Derval Castle is an ancient fortified castle, the remains of which stand in the woods, 2.5 kilometres north-northeast of the town of Derval, in the French department of Loire-Atlantique.
